    Also, all Canadian spec 2nd gens have a chip key, regardless of trim level - including base and 4cyl models.

    On an immobilizer equipped truck, a plain key will work fine for the doors, and allow the use of accessory power, turn the ignition power on, and even crank the engine. It won't start though.
